I had to replace my evaporator, I did what I had to. Remove the dash. Lets start from the beginning, I disconnected the negative battery cable, removed the dash skin, the mounting bar, and the duct work. Replaced everything, the A/C works beautiful. Everything works but the radio, the clock, and ambient temperature readout.   I checked all my fuses, removed the skin again to double check my connections, and checked for pushed pins. I'm stumped! The next thing I need to do is trace the wiring.   Has anyone ever experienced the radio not working after a dash removal? Did I do wrong by only disconnecting the negative battery cable, should I have disconnected the positive cable as well?
